Firstly, it’s essential to understand the basic functionality of the PLC controller in the烘房. It regulates temperature, humidity, and other vital parameters, ensuring the products undergo the right conditions during the baking process. It also helps in maintaining consistent quality and preventing any damage to the products due to fluctuations in the environment.
